This template demonstarte how to apply soft start, if not supported own ESC.
Warning signal on, if throttle cut active but flight mode switch not ID0.
Warning signal on, if Gyro not switched headlock mode.

Original source: random sweep.

ch1,2,3 = AIL, ELE, PIT servos
ch4 = rudder servo (to GYro in)
ch5 = THR (ESC)
ch6 = Gyro sensitivy
ID0= 1 idle0, -2° pith hold, cyclic is normal (c1,c4) (if c4 and c1 curve modify the flmode is normal for idle0) (pitch curve= c4)
ID1 =1 idle1, curve (c2) (pitch curve= c5)
ID2 = 1 idle2, curve (c3) (pitch curve= c6)
THR switch = Throttle cut.
ch11 pitch servo (virtual channel)

if gear=1 (rate mode) then warning audio.
if THR sw=0 and id1 or id2=1 then warning soud active (motor off but flight mode not id0)
if ID0=1 and THR switch=1 then ignition (slow start).

modify ch1,2,3 and ch11 to collective and ciclyc pitch.

ch15, ch16, sw1, sw2 = soft start slave ch and sw
sw3, sw4, sw5 = warning sign switch (idle0,1,2)

valid (flying and fine tuned) ALIGN 450 setup
please check and fix the limits, trim, throttle curves, pitch curves, subtrim and rudder direction.

switch:
id0=ignition start mode
id1 id2 3d setup middle and high rpm.
thottle cut= motor on/off
elev and ail= low/mid/high expo
gear=gyro mode rate/headlock
trainer= light on

cv1= start throttle curve
cv2, cv3 = id0, 1 throttle curve
cv4,5,6 = id1,2,3 pitch curve

The file is the same whether you use the Win, mac or linux version of eepe.

If you use eepe you'd better use the Windows version, as the Mac version is outdated and doesn't support the current er9x revision. If you use companion9x both versions are in sync.
